200+ year old 2 bedroomed cottage North West English Lake District and Coast

“T’uther Cottage” (best said with a Northern England accent) is a 2 bedroomed 200+ year old cottage with an Oak beamed roof .The cottage was completely renovated and modernised over 5 years being completed in 2019.
Located in a quiet village 3 miles from the UNESCO world heritage site of the Lake district National park,less than 4 miles from the Georgian gem town of Cockermouth and 6 miles from the Solway coast the variety of scenery and activities are endless. The cottage blends original features of Oak beams in the roof that were recycled 200 years ago from former sailing ships plus an original stone fire place with everyday modern comforts such as Wifi ,Washing machine and central heating.
The cottage contains 2 upstairs bedrooms. The 1st bedroom has a double bed, the second bedroom has 2 single beds and these can be combined with the option to use a fully sprung bed settee in the downstairs lounge. ( NOTE THE COTTAGE IS NOT SUITABLE FOR 5 ADULTS).
Upstairs in addition to the 2 bedrooms there is also a full size bathroom containing seperate bath and shower.
Downstairs the lounge features an original stone fireplace with stove and timbered ceiling which are complimented by Oak flooring made from locally sourced Cumbrian Oak timber. In the lounge in addition to the TV and a selection of DVD's you will also find a selection of childrens and family games provided for your enjoyment, alongside Information on local attractions and places to visit. Off the lounge is a seperate dining area.The fitted kitchen contains Hob,Oven, Microwave, Fridge,Freezer and Washing machine.
For families with young children a travel cot and high chair are available on request.
Outside to the rear of the property is a self contained private raised garden with outdoor table and chairs and a gas BBQ.
PLEASE NOTE though we welcome pets the rear garden is NOT suitable to exercise pets but there are suitable walks within 15 meters of the property.
Pets are not to be left unattended in the property at ANY time.
On arrival guests are provided with a complimentary welcome pack that includes tea,coffee,sugar,hot chocolate and milk.There is free parking available in an off road communal car park 20 metres away.
If you are here to see the Lakes themselves Loweswater, Buttermere, Crummock water, Ennerdale water, Bassenthwaite and Derwent water are all within a 20 minute drive. Further afield the historic city of Carlisle ,Gretna Green, the Southern Lake District and the UNESCO World heritage site of Hadrians wall can be reached in around 1 hour by car.
In addition to the fells and lakes of the Lake District National Park the cottage is ideally located to explore the unspoilt Solway coast an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ty.This quiet village location offers a change from the busy tourist hotspots of Keswick and Ambleside whilst still having the beauty of the surrounding local area with country walks starting from outside your front door . For history lovers the neighbouring village of Eaglesfield can claim to be the birth place of John Dalton proposer of the modern Atomic theory and Fletcher Christian of Mutiny on the Bounty fame.
